SEC Form 4 — Statement of Changes in Beneficial Ownership

Issuer: REGENCY CENTERS CORP (REG)
CIK: 0000910606
Period of Report: 2010-02-02

Reporting Person: STEIN MARTIN E JR (Director, Chairman and CEO)

Non-Derivative Transactions

Date Security Code Shares Price A/D Holdings After Ownership
2010-02-02 Common Stock A 19285 Acquired 232994 Direct
2010-03-10 Common Stock G 400 Disposed 232594 Direct

Holdings (Non-Derivative)

Security Shares Ownership
Common Stock 2473 Indirect
Common Stock 196528 Indirect
Common Stock 160263 Indirect
Common Stock 415382 Indirect
Common Stock 4000 Indirect

Footnotes

F1: Grant of restricted stock under the Issuer's Long-Term Omnibus Plan. Shares vest 25% per year beginning February 2, 2011.

F2: By a trust for the benefit of the Reporting Person's granddaughter for which he is a trustee.

F3: Represents (1) 6,307 remainder shares held in a grantor retained annuity trust of which the Reporting Person is the trustee
and the beneficiaries of which are the Reporting Person's children (none of whom shares the same home with him); (2) 41,072
shares and 44,636 shares held by two additional grantor retained annuity trusts, repsectively, of which the Reporting Person
is the trustee and current annuitant and his children are remainder beneficiaries; and (3) 20,585 shares held by a trust of
which the Reporting Person is the trustee and his children are the beneficiaries.

F4: By a corporation which is controlled by the Reporting Person's family.

F5: By two general partnerships, in which the Reporting Person is a general partner.

F6: By a trust for the Reporting Person's benefit.
